NJW1138 P R E L I M I N A LY AUDIO PROCESSOR www.datasheet4u.com s GENERAL DESCRIPTION The NJW1138 is an audio processor. It includes all of functions processing audio signal for TV, such as tone control, balance, volume, mute, NJRC original surround, and AGC functions.
